 The Oslo Massacre and the Motivation of Mass Murder
HLN's Joy Behar Show featured forensic psychiatrist Dr. Michael Welner, Chairman of The Forensic Panel, discussing myths and facts of the Norway tragedy and those who carry out mass shooting attacks. Dr. Welner, who has examined several surviving mass shooters in his casework, believes mass murder to be a preventable crime, and recommends a press strategy for eliminating mass shooting as a social scourge. Dr. Welner added to his televised comments by noting, 'Spectacle mass murderers graft ideas shared by many and attach them to a grandiose nihilism that recognizes they will become larger than life if they kill many, or kill shockingly...'

 Testimony, Thoroughness & Peer Review Key in Civil Court Ruling on Rare Diagnostic Puzzle
Judge credits The Panel's Dr. Merlino in spurning emotional damages. In a surprise conclusion to a complex dispute of a former New York state prisoner, Judge Thomas Scuccimarra rejected huge plaintiff's damages demands for injuries that claimed paralysis, incontinence, and a host of related disabilities.

 Chief Medical Examiner Unflinching in Face of Death
It was early in the fourth grade back in his hometown of Bulawayo, Zimbabwe, that Dr. David R. Fowler first realized he wanted to work with corpses. Now the chief medical examiner for the state of Maryland, Fowler took time out during the opening celebration and tour of the state's new $44million Forensic Medical Center in Baltimore on Sept. 21 to talk about the choices that landed him one of the state's most prestigious and misunderstood jobs.
